An application of nonlinear supratransmission to the propagation of binary signals in weakly damped, mechanical systems of coupled oscillators

arXiv:1112.0583 · doi:10.1016/j.physleta.2007.03.076

Abstract

In the present article, we simulate the propagation of binary signals in semi-infinite, mechanical chains of coupled oscillators harmonically driven at the end, by making use of the recently discovered process of nonlinear supratransmission. Our numerical results ---which are based on a brand-new computational technique with energy-invariant properties--- show an efficient and reliable transmission of information.
